Features
  • Lightweight, well-balanced design with superior spin and speed

  • Japanese Addoy rubber designed for control

  • Flared comfort handle

  • Five-ply Basswood

  • 1.5-millimeter sponge

5Need to improve? Naifu is for you!  Apr 09, 2008 By E. Cortez
I started playing a year ago and I've been playing with a Stiga Ultimate which has a 2.2 mm sponge. I wanted to work more on technique because I had been relying on spin too much. With the 2.2 mm sponge I was sending the ball long when I started to try looping so I figured I'd try the Naifu with the 1.5 mm sponge. It is MUCH easier to control the ball. I can give nice forehand or backhand looping stroke and keep the ball on the table. It's also easier to return a smash with the Naifu because of the thin sponge and lack of strong spin. The downside is that the spin and speed I was relying on in my offensive game to force my opponent to make a mistake is almost non-existent with the Naifu. I played with it for about 50 games and when I switched back to the 2.2 mm sponge, my game was A LOT better. Bottom line - use the Naifu to work on technique but keep your ego in check - you won't win too many matches against an experienced opponent but it definitely will help you to improve your game.
